According to ESPN's Bobby Marks, the Warriors are reportedly eyeing former All-Star center Brook Lopez of the Milwaukee Bucks, who is an unrestricted free agent this offseason.
"I think the one name to keep an eye on regarding that center position is Brook Lopez," Marks said on NBA Today.
"The center market is thin. When you look at Myles Turner, you’re probably not going to afford him, so the next best big out there is Brook Lopez."
Marks also noted that Lopez would likely be available on a one-year deal that wouldn't be too expensive.
The 37-year-old Lopez averaged 13.0 points, 5.0 rebounds, and 1.9 blocks across 80 games for the Bucks this season. Despite his age, he remains a strong interior defender and offers valuable floor spacing with his outside shooting.
